Tempest Storm personifies the classic burlesque tradition. From her roots
as a poor sharecropper's daughter in Eastman, Georgia, she emerged as one
of the most enduring provocateurs in the entertainment arena. Parlaying
her beauty, talent, and fabled 39-1/2'' bust (which the press revealed was
insured for $1,000,000) into an icon of media mythology, the Titian-tressed
diva rubbed shoulders--and sometimes more--with Elvis Presley, Mickey Rooney,
Sammy Davis Jr., Hugh O'Brien, Nat King Cole, Englebert Humperdinck, and
John Kennedy, to become the only
stripper to play Carnegie Hall.
